INSPECTION NOTE RECORDLED BY HON’BLE MEMBER SHRI AVINASH RAI KHANNA ON THE VISIT TO GOVT. RANDHIR  COLLEGE , SANGRUR  ON 22-08-2009.

                                            

                   On 22-8-2009 at about 1 PM I visited the Govt. Randhir College, Sangrur. The Principal of the College and other Teachers also accompanied me while inspecting the College.  My observations are as under:-

          1.       Zoology Department

First of all I visited the Zoology Department.  The toilets and bath rooms in this Department were dirty and the building was not of good condition. The water taps fitted in the lavatory were not working properly. The museum of the Department was also not neat and clean as it should be.

          2.       Botany Lab.

I visited the Botany lab in which the class was going on. The students and the Teacher of the class were sitting in a room where the fans were not working. In fact, the class room was without proper fans,

                   3.       Arts Block

The Arts Block building was in a dilapidated condition, it        needs heavy repair immediately. The windows and doors of the rooms were not properly fixed. So many windows and doors of the rooms were without planks. One room in the Arts Block has been declared by the PWD Department unfit and unsafe for human habitation.

          There was an old Hostel Building which has been given to the faculty of the College. In this building, three computer labs were working and these were equipped with computers, and is having six Teachers to teach the students. There is also an extension of State Bank of Patiala in the College.

4.       Boundary wall 

          The College requires a boundary wall for the proper safety of the College.

5.       Canteen

          The canteen was not hygienic. It was not neat and clean. The fans fitted in the canteen were not running properly. There is a provision for the sitting of girls and boys students separately.

6.       Conference Hall

          Although it is a newly constructed building, yet it is incomplete.  It is having no proper sitting arrangement and is also having no sound system.

7.       Post-Graduate Block

          It is also a newly constructed block having 8 rooms but without any corridor.

8.       Sports Department

          There are two Teachers in the Sports Deptt.  College participate in 25 Events. The College has its own stadium which needs repair and more construction as per requirement of the sports persons. No ground boy is posted in this Department. It is also having no class-iv employee. It has been reported that there is no problem of sports material in this Department.

9.       Sewerage

The sewerage of the College is not connected with the sewerage of the Municipal Committee. All the sewerage has been put by digging the pits.

                   10.     Drinking water facility 

          There are five water coolers in the college premises for the use of the students and the staff.

          College is having NSS and NCC units. 

          The separate career counselling/placement cell has been working in the College.

11.     Physics Lab. 

          There are two physics labs in the College. The building is not in a good condition. One of the labs is looking like a store in which waste material is stored. The  dark room physics lab is also like a store. Though in the second lab some material is lying for doing practical, but only one bulb and one fan was fitted in the lab.

12.     Chemistry Lab.

          There are two chemistry labs in the College, but no water tap was working at the time of the visit to the labs. In the labs two bulbs and two fans were working. It needs more staff. The labs were not so neat and clean as these should be.

13.     Staff Room

          The staff room was properly furnished, but toilets and wash rooms were not neat and clean.

14.     Girls Common Room

          It was not in a good condition. It was also attached with a toilet.

15.     Library

          The books were lying in the library, but it was not in a proper building and there is no Librarian posted in the library. It is being run by the Restorer.

At the time of my visit, the classes were going on. The students were studying in the classes. There was no hue and cry and the classes were going on in a disciplined manner. Even the students sitting and roaming in the college compound were also disciplined.

          The students had reported that they are facing difficulties while coming to the College as the private buses do not allow them to board the buses and the Govt. buses sometimes do not stop near the College.

16.     Staff 

          There is a shortage of Lecturers, Clerks, Sweepers, Librarian and Electrician etc.

          RECOMMENDATIONS 

                   (i)      The laboratories should be equipped with the required material     

so that the students could do practical in a proper manner. Proper staff be provided to keep these laboratories neat and clean.

                   (ii)     A permanent qualified Librarian be posted in the Library.

                    (iii)   There is no post of electrician in the College. A post of Electrician be created to be posted in the College.

                    (iv)   There is no Gardener in the College. Seeing the area of the College, one Gardener is required to be posted in the College.

(v)     The canteen should be made hygienic so that the students can take healthy/proper food from the canteen. The canteen building which is in a dilapidated condition should be repaired immediately so that any untoward incident may not happen.

 (vi)  The doors and window which need heavy repair should be repaired on priority basis.

(vii)   The fans, electric tubes and bulbs in class rooms which are not working, either they should be replaced or put on working condition.

(viii)  There is no security in or near the college premises. Taking in view the number of the students in the College, proper security arrangements be made in the College.

(ix)    Conference Hall be completed immediately, otherwise with the passage of time it will become worthless.

(x)     The College be given a sewerage connection so  that the ground level water may not get polluted.

(xi)    A corridor be provided in  the Post-Graduate Block, otherwise it will also become worthless.

(xii)   To give proper look to the College, the grass standing therein be immediately cut and removed. By appointing a Gardener, a park can be developed in the College.   

(xiii)  The administrative building also needs repair.  It be got repaired according to the need.

(xiv)  The office of the Principal is situated on one side of the building of the college and it is very difficult for him/her to control the College affairs from a side.  A proper site/room be provided for the office of the Principal. The office of the Principal should be shifted to a proper side of the College Building from where he/she may easily control the college affairs.
